High-throughput Fabrication of Advanced 3d Microfluidic Devices in Thermoplastic Elastomer for Biological Probe Immobilization
We have developed a process based on hot-embossing lithography (HEL) to pattern at high-throughput micron-size through-holes in thin thermoplastic elastomer (TPE) membranes. The objective of this work is to develop a multiscale modeling tool of copolymers with long chains. We propose an enhanced coarse-graining method of thermoplastic polyurethane (TPU) with three beads. The proposed coarse-graining provides an accurate molecular modeling tool to keep the molecular interaction together with computational efficiency. This paper advances the design of Rod Pre-strained Dielectric Elastomer Actuators (RP-DEAs) in their capability to generate comparatively large static actuation forces with increased lifetime via optimized electrode arrangements.
